>>11873626>>11873628For the sword and the body smudges, your best bet is wiping it with isopropyl alcohol. Anything stronger mighty start to strip off the base coat of paint.

>>11873758I don't think he was being hostile, just blunt. What he said about the leg dimple might work, but I think that will only work if the dimple was formed after the plastic had fully cooled, like when a twist tie in the packaging causes a dent. I've got a feeling that happened during molding and heat won't help. Definitely give it a shot though.
